请启用Javascript以获得更好的浏览体验~
品创集团
0755-3394 2933
在线咨询
演示申请
小程序开发全攻略:从零到一的实战指南
小程序开发全攻略:从零到一的实战指南

本文旨在为初学者提供一份详尽的小程序开发指南,涵盖开发环境搭建、基础语法学习、实战项目开发等关键环节,助力您快速上手小程序开发。

小程序开发全攻略:从零到一的实战指南
一、引言

随着移动互联网的迅猛发展,小程序作为一种轻量级的应用形式,凭借其无需下载安装、即用即走的特点,迅速赢得了广大用户的喜爱。对于开发者而言,小程序开发不仅门槛相对较低,而且能够直接触达海量用户,因此成为了众多创业者和企业关注的焦点。本文将为您提供一份从零到一的小程序开发全攻略,帮助您快速入门并提升开发技能。

二、开发环境搭建

  1. 注册开发者账号:首先,您需要在微信小程序公众平台注册一个开发者账号,完成相关认证后,即可获得开发者权限。

  2. 下载并安装开发工具:微信官方提供了小程序开发者工具,支持代码编写、预览、调试等功能。您可以从微信小程序公众平台下载并安装该工具。

  3. 配置开发环境:在开发者工具中,您需要创建一个小程序项目,并配置项目名称、目录结构、AppID等信息。完成配置后,即可开始编写代码。

三、基础语法学习

  1. WXML与WXSS:WXML(WeiXin Markup Language)是微信小程序的标记语言,类似于HTML;WXSS(WeiXin Style Sheets)则是微信小程序的样式表语言,类似于CSS。掌握这两种语言,是开发小程序的基础。

  2. JavaScript交互逻辑:小程序中的交互逻辑主要通过JavaScript实现。您需要学习如何使用JavaScript编写事件处理函数、数据绑定等交互逻辑。

  3. API调用:微信小程序提供了丰富的API接口,如网络请求、文件操作、用户授权等。掌握这些API的调用方法,能够帮助您实现更多功能。

四、实战项目开发

  1. 项目需求分析:在开发小程序之前,您需要对项目进行需求分析,明确项目的目标用户、功能需求、设计风格等关键信息。

  2. 界面设计:根据需求分析结果,您可以使用设计工具(如Sketch、Figma等)进行界面设计。设计完成后,将设计稿转换为WXML与WXSS代码。

  3. 功能实现:在界面设计的基础上,您需要编写JavaScript代码实现各项功能。这包括数据绑定、事件处理、API调用等关键环节。

  4. 测试与优化:完成功能实现后,您需要对小程序进行测试,确保各项功能正常运行且用户体验良好。同时,根据测试结果进行优化调整。

五、提升开发效率与质量

  1. 版本控制:使用Git等版本控制工具,能够帮助您更好地管理代码版本,提高团队协作效率。

  2. 持续集成/持续部署(CI/CD):通过配置CI/CD流程,可以实现代码的自动化构建、测试与部署,提高开发效率与质量。

  3. 性能优化:针对小程序加载速度、内存占用等方面进行优化,能够提升用户体验。例如,减少不必要的网络请求、优化图片资源等。

  4. 用户体验设计:注重用户体验设计,如提供清晰的导航结构、简洁明了的界面布局等,能够提升用户满意度与留存率。

六、结语

小程序开发是一个不断学习与进步的过程。通过不断实践与积累经验,您将能够掌握更多高级技能与最佳实践。同时,关注行业动态与技术趋势,及时调整技术选型与项目策略,也是提升小程序开发能力的重要途径。希望本文能够为您提供一份有价值的小程序开发指南,助力您在小程序开发领域取得更多成就。